Output ec8e3576da646fcaf41ca0deda2620118f84d19a56d4d38ddd82aad36b6cda61:0

value
10383863
script pubkey
OP_0 OP_PUSHBYTES_20 9074ed5cd0ef7e33fd1b22aa74dcc707c66ce578
address
bc1qjp6w6hxsaalr8lgmy248fhx8qlrxeetcp6uudr
transaction
ec8e3576da646fcaf41ca0deda2620118f84d19a56d4d38ddd82aad36b6cda61